Resumo: | Glyphosate was determined in runoff and leaching waters in agricultural soil that received an application of active ingredient and was exposed to simulated intensive rain conditions. The concentrations decreased during the simulation period and the concentrations of the runoff were higher than those achieved in the samples of leaching waters. The concentrations were lower than the pattern in the Brazilian Regulation MS N. 518/2004 for drinking water. The transported load of the applied active ingredient by the leaching was of 15.4% (w/w) and for the runoff was of 1.7% (w/w). |
